TypeDelegator.GetEvent(String, BindingFlags) Metod

Definition

Returnerar den angivna händelsen.

public:
 override System::Reflection::EventInfo ^ GetEvent(System::String ^ name, System::Reflection::BindingFlags bindingAttr);
[System.Diagnostics.CodeAnalysis.DynamicallyAccessedMembers(System.Diagnostics.CodeAnalysis.DynamicallyAccessedMemberTypes.NonPublicEvents | System.Diagnostics.CodeAnalysis.DynamicallyAccessedMemberTypes.PublicEvents)]
public override System.Reflection.EventInfo? GetEvent(string name, System.Reflection.BindingFlags bindingAttr);
public override System.Reflection.EventInfo GetEvent(string name, System.Reflection.BindingFlags bindingAttr);
public override System.Reflection.EventInfo? GetEvent(string name, System.Reflection.BindingFlags bindingAttr);
[<System.Diagnostics.CodeAnalysis.DynamicallyAccessedMembers(System.Diagnostics.CodeAnalysis.DynamicallyAccessedMemberTypes.NonPublicEvents | System.Diagnostics.CodeAnalysis.DynamicallyAccessedMemberTypes.PublicEvents)>]
override this.GetEvent : string * System.Reflection.BindingFlags -> System.Reflection.EventInfo
override this.GetEvent : string * System.Reflection.BindingFlags -> System.Reflection.EventInfo
Public Overrides Function GetEvent (name As String, bindingAttr As BindingFlags) As EventInfo

Parametrar

name
String

Namnet på den händelse som ska hämtas.

bindingAttr
BindingFlags

En bitmask som påverkar hur sökningen utförs. Värdet är en kombination av noll eller fler bitflaggor från BindingFlags.

Returer

Ett EventInfo objekt som representerar händelsen som deklarerats eller ärvts av den här typen med det angivna namnet. Den här metoden returnerar null om ingen sådan händelse hittas.

Attribut

Undantag

Parametern name är null.

Kommentarer

Om bindingAttr är BindingFlags.IgnoreCase, ignoreras fallet med parametern name .

Gäller för